John Simmons

John Earl Simmons
Born: July 7, 1924
Birmingham, AL US
Deceased: August 1, 2008
Farmingdale, NY US
Primary Position: Outfield
Bats: Right
Throws: Right
Height: 6'1"
Weight: 192
Career: 1942-1954
Major League Statistics

John Simmons compiled a career batting average of .264 with 51 home runs and 229 RBI in his 807-game career with the Fond du Lac Panthers, Amsterdam Rugmakers, Binghamton Triplets, Norfolk Tars, Montreal Royals, Pueblo Dodgers, Mobile Bears, St. Paul Saints, Fort Worth Cats, Charleston Rebels and Montgomery Rebels. He began playing during the 1942 season and last took the field during the 1954 campaign.
